Hey mate ... I also had the shuddering brakes (ie. Warped Disks) so I swapped mine out for RDA Slotted rotors and funny enuff EBC Green Stuff Pads. They r excellent pads (u'll get a shock when u first brake heavily as the outer coating smokes up heaps). Very good brake pad for the money. The guys doing track work use the Red Stuff or a combo of both (red front, green back).
Definately worth it. I have seen a few other people on other forums give them a good wrap.

I have been racing with the EBC range for a long time now and if its s every day car with occasional track use, then they EBC's are fantastic. I run Red Stuff on the front on race day and go back to green stuff for street driving. But I have customers who have raced with the green stuffs and had no problems at all. highly recomend them.
